The Gitton Père et Fils estate is located around the village of "Ménétréol-sous-Sancerre" on the banks of the Canal Latéral à la Loire. The vineyards, covering an area of 33 hectares, are 80% sauvignon and 20% pinot noir, planted on small plots around the village. These numerous plots now make it possible to offer a dozen different White Sancerre.....
Anecdotes about the domain
Our parcels "En creux" and "Larrey", both on the same hillside and the same terroir, were already mentioned by Abbé Poupard in 1777 as two of the four best white Sancerre crus in the History of Sancerre.

The domain's short story
The history of the Gitton vineyards goes back to 1945 when Marcel and Huguette Gitton bought half a hectare of vines in the Sancerrois region to support the family bistro. Little by little, Marcel, a vineyard worker with a passion for vines, extended his vineyard by acquiring small plots around his village. With this diversity of terroirs, Marcel quickly made the choice of parcel-based vinification by separating all the vintages by locality, according to exposure, rootstock and soil. This family tradition is perpetuated today by his son Pascal and his wife Denise, helped by their daughter Chanel.
